Here is the big reveal! My of you have been asking me to cut it open. As you can see, it hasn't rotted on the inside.

It IS very dried out and it cracked when I cut it open. Even with the ketchup and cheese, the burger didn't rot.

I PROMISE to get a control burger going (homemade bread, burger, real cheese) and see what happens.
